CRgn::CreateEllipticRgnIndirect

Crea una región elíptico.

BOOL CreateEllipticRgnIndirect(
   LPCRECT lpRect 
);

Parámetros

  • lpRect
    Señala RECT estructurados o un objeto de CRect que contiene las coordenadas lógicas superior izquierda y las esquinas inferior derecha del rectángulo delimitador de la elipse.

Valor devuelto

Distinto de cero si la operación se realizó correctamente; si no 0.

Comentarios

La región está definida por la estructura o el objeto indicada por lpRect y almacenada en el objeto de CRgn .

El tamaño de una región está limitado a 32.767 por 32.767 unidades lógicas o a de memoria de, lo que sea menor.

Cuando haya terminado de utilizar una región creada con la función de CreateEllipticRgnIndirect , una aplicación debe seleccionar la región fuera del contexto de dispositivo y utilizar la función de DeleteObject para quitarlo.

Ejemplo

Vea el ejemplo para CRgn::CreateRectRgnIndirect.

Requisitos

encabezado: afxwin.h

Vea también

Referencia

Clase de CRgn

Gráfico de jerarquía

CRgn::CreateEllipticRgn

CreateEllipticRgnIndirect